Zenity Highlights Continuous Contextual Security Offering for AI Agents

According to a recent LinkedIn post from Zenity, the company is promoting what it describes as “continuous, contextual security for AI agents,” positioned as a way to track AI risk as it accumulates over time rather than as isolated events. The post emphasizes capabilities such as monitoring exposure changes in real time, understanding behavior across sessions, and correlating multiple security signals into what it presents as actionable risk insights.

The post suggests this functionality underpins what Zenity refers to as “Guardian Agents,” aiming to provide a context layer that can enable more timely security interventions for AI systems. For investors, this focus indicates Zenity is targeting the emerging AI security and governance segment, which could enhance its relevance to enterprises deploying AI agents at scale and potentially support future revenue growth if customer adoption materializes.

The reference to a live demonstration at the RSAC Conference points to an effort to build visibility among cybersecurity decision makers and to validate the technology in front of an industry audience. While the post is promotional in nature and does not disclose commercial metrics or customer wins, it signals ongoing product development in AI security that could strengthen Zenity’s competitive positioning as organizations seek tools to manage the operational risks of AI deployment.
